Quarter-Sized Hail, Damage To Buildings Reported From Monday's Storms In Frankfort

Over 500 customers remain without power in the Frankfort area from Monday's severe weather.

FRANKFORT, IL — Severe weather on Monday brought power outages, downed trees and branches, and flooding to Frankfort, and the National Weather Service crews are still assessing damage across the Chicago area.

No tornadoes have been confirmed in Frankfort; but the National Weather Service did confirm an EF-0 tornado which impacted western and northwest Orland Park, a tornado which hit Country Club Hills, Hazel Crest, Harvey and Homewood; and an EF-0 in Lansing.

Several thousand people were also originally without power in Frankfort after Monday's storms. As of noon on Wednesday, 337 customers remain without power in Frankfort, 261 are without power in Frankfort Square, and 113 are without power in Frankfort Township, according to the ComEd outage map.
